Product Overview



Parameter Details
Part Number SDCS-IOB-3-COAT / 3ADT220090R0020
Product Name SDCS-IOB-3-COAT External Isolated Analog I/O Board (Coated)
Application Analog and encoder input/output interface for ABB DCS500/DCS800 series DC drives in industrial automation systems
Compatibility Compatible with ABB DCS500 and DCS800 drive systems, including control boards like SDCS-CON and power modules
Function Provides external isolated analog I/O and encoder interface with conformal coating for enhanced environmental protection

Functional Specifications



Parameter Details
I/O Type Analog inputs/outputs with encoder interface (e.g., 4 analog inputs, 2 outputs, encoder channels)
Voltage Rating 115 V AC / 230 V AC variants; 24 V DC logic levels
Isolation External galvanic isolation for noise immunity and safety
Operating Temperature -10°C to +55°C
Storage Temperature -40°C to +70°C
Dimensions Standard PCB size for rack mounting (approximate: 16 cm x 10 cm x 2 cm)
Weight 0.19 kg to 0.35 kg
Mounting Rack-mounted for industrial drive applications
Protection ESD protection, overvoltage safeguards, conformal coating for harsh environments (dust, moisture resistance)
Certifications CE marked; RoHS compliant; suitable for industrial environments
Standards Compliance IEC 61131-2 compliant for programmable controllers; API 670 for related drive protection

Ordering Information



Parameter Details
Part Number Configuration 3ADT220090R0020 (SDCS-IOB-3-COAT Analog I/O Board with conformal coating)
Available Options Non-coated version (SDCS-IOB-3), variants for 115 V / 230 V AC, coated for enhanced protection
Customization Integration with specific ABB DCS configurations or additional isolation available upon request
